Corporate profile

TOP research team is specialized in the generation of vectors, cells and animals for Molecular Imaging using:

Bioluminescence

PET (Positron Emission Tomography)

NMR (Nuclear Magnetic Resonance)

TOP srl, originated in 2006 as a spin-off of the University of Milan and has been backed in 2007 by the NEXT fund managed by Finlombarda Gestioni SGR.

TOP is located at the Parco Tecnologico Padano in Lodi, near Milan.

Page 3: Spin-off dell'Università di Milano  speranze e successi

TOP missionTo provide the scientific community with non-invasive tools for

the study of the activity of drugs and environmental or food contaminants

TOP aims at combining the power of physics, informatics and molecular biology to generate novel models for the bio-medical research and for the control of the environment and alimentary chain.

TOP strives to renew present investigational tools in the respect of animal rights to satisfy two conflicting needs: use of predictive biological models in the absence of animal distress.

Partnership

TOP srl is partner of Caliper Life Sciences (former Xenogen) , the world leader for in vivo optical imaging.

Page 11: Spin-off dell'Università di Milano  speranze e successi

repTOP™ mice available at present:

Models Therapeutic areas:

repTOP™ ERE-Luc mouse (Estrogen Receptors)

•Aging-related pathologies•Depression•Inflammation

repTOP™ PPRE-Luc mouse (PPAR’s)

•Lipid metabolism alteration•Diabetes •Cancers and others

repTOP™ MITO mouse (“MITO as in MITOSIS”)

•Oncology•Regenerative medicine•Toxicology

repTOPTM Ubi-Luc2 (series) mouse + VivoGloTM

• Metabolism (CYP3A4) • Apoptosis (Caspase 3/7)
